the structures in the universe have a hierarchical relationship. this means they are organized such that the smaller structures are contained within the larger structures. which model best represents how the universe is organized?

Brief Explanations:

In the universe's hierarchical organization, planetary - systems are within galaxies, galaxies are part of galaxy groups, and galaxy groups are in superclusters, all of which are in the universe. The correct model should show this nested relationship.
